They pick resources that do three simple things well: cover the ISC syllabus clearly, provide exam-style practice, and train you to present answers in the way the exam demands. This post is a friendly, practical walkthrough of how top-performing students treat their books \u2014 how they choose them, how they use them, and how to turn those pages into marks.<\/p>\n<p><img src='https:\/\/asset.sparkl.me\/pb\/blogs-image\/img\/cbd05937682449059c292b064860546c.jpg' alt='Photo Idea : A neat study desk with ISC books, handwritten notes, and a cup of tea'><\/p>\n<h2>Why the right books matter (and what toppers actually look for)<\/h2>\n<p>Books are tools. The right tool used well makes the job easier; the wrong tool used a lot wastes time. Toppers evaluate books not by how thick or flashy they are but by fit and function. In plain terms, they look for: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Clear syllabus alignment \u2014 chapters that map directly to ISC units so nothing important is missed.<\/li>\n<li>Concise explanations and worked examples that build understanding before practice.<\/li>\n<li>Exam-style questions and previous-paper patterns so revision is realistic.<\/li>\n<li>Marking-smart presentation tips \u2014 how to write answers so markers can award method and structure marks easily.<\/li>\n<li>Progressively challenging practice sets: concept checks, short answers, and full-length papers.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Toppers use books as a learning ladder: conceptual clarity first, then guided practice, and finally timed full-paper simulations.<\/p>\n<h2>Board textbooks versus supplementary books \u2014 using both without overload<\/h2>\n<p>Top students don\u2019t pick a side; they balance. A core textbook that follows the ISC syllabus gives the baseline \u2014 definitions, core examples, and the official scope. Supplementary books are for depth: more solved problems, alternate explanations, and varied practice. The trick is to avoid duplication: use the core book for fundamentals and one or two focused supplementary resources for extra practice or conceptual reinforcement.<\/p>\n<h3>How toppers combine them<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>First read: Core text to build the concept map.<\/li>\n<li>Second read: A concise reference or guide to see alternate approaches and tricks for tricky topics.<\/li>\n<li>Practice phase: Solve exam-style questions from a practice book and timed past-paper sets.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>How to choose the right books \u2014 a quick checklist toppers use<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Syllabus coverage: Do chapter titles map to the ISC syllabus units?<\/li>\n<li>Depth vs clarity: Prefer clear explanations over encyclopedic detail.<\/li>\n<li>Worked examples: Are they stepwise with method notes?<\/li>\n<li>Practice quality: Are there past-paper style questions and model answers?<\/li>\n<li>Presentation cues: Does the book highlight how to answer for marks (headings, labelling, units)?<\/li>\n<li>Revision aids: quick summaries, formula lists, and topic-wise practice.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Subject-wise approach: what type of books toppers rely on<\/h2>\n<p>Different subjects demand different resource habits. The table below summarises subject-specific book types and how toppers typically use them.<\/p>\n<div class=\"table-responsive\"><table border='1' cellpadding='6' cellspacing='0'>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Subject<\/th>\n<th>Type of Book Toppers Prefer<\/th>\n<th>How Toppers Use It<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>English (Language &#038; Literature)<\/td>\n<td>Annotated texts, model-answer collections, composition guides<\/td>\n<td>Annotate themes, practise unseen passages, memorise model phrases and structure for compositions<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Mathematics<\/td>\n<td>Concise theory + large bank of graded problems<\/td>\n<td>Master worked examples, then solve graded problems by topic and timed full papers<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Physics<\/td>\n<td>Conceptual notes, problem sets, lab manual<\/td>\n<td>Understand derivations, do numerical practice, rehearse experimental steps<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Chemistry<\/td>\n<td>Theory summaries, mechanism walkthroughs, reaction tables<\/td>\n<td>Create reaction maps, practise numerical and organic mechanism questions<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Biology<\/td>\n<td>Clear diagrams, pointwise notes, practice questions<\/td>\n<td>Redraw diagrams, write crisp definitions, practise long-answer structuring<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Economics \/ Accountancy<\/td>\n<td>Theory-explanation books, solved numerical sets, project\/workbook templates<\/td>\n<td>Follow stepwise solutions, review answer presentation for ledgers and diagrams<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>History \/ Humanities<\/td>\n<td>Concise timelines, analytical notes, sample answers<\/td>\n<td>Practice structured answers, learn to link evidence and interpretation<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table><\/div>\n<h2>Practical step-by-step: how toppers actually study from a book<\/h2>\n<p>Reading a chapter is just step one. The process of turning reading into marks is systematic: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Preview the chapter: scan headings, bolded words, and objectives.<\/li>\n<li>Learn actively: write short margin notes, make one-line summaries at the end of each section.<\/li>\n<li>Work examples: rework solved examples without looking; then compare to spot gaps.<\/li>\n<li>Practice varied questions: do short questions first, then long answers, then full timed papers.<\/li>\n<li>Self-mark: use model answers to identify missing points and presentation issues.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Example: using a physics chapter<\/h3>\n<p>Start by understanding definitions and units, derive the key formula once on paper, solve 3\u20134 worked examples, then attempt 8\u201310 practice problems including at least one that mimics the difficulty of a past paper question. Finish by making a one-page formula-and-concept sheet for quick revision.<\/p>\n<h2>Mocks, marking and time management \u2014 what toppers prioritise<\/h2>\n<p>Toppers treat mock tests like litmus tests, not just revision. They design mock sittings to mirror exam conditions and use marking schemes to refine presentation. A practical mock strategy looks like this: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Regular full-length mocks under timed conditions to build stamina and pacing.<\/li>\n<li>Marking using official-style rubrics or model answers \u2014 focus on method marks as much as final answers.<\/li>\n<li>Post-mock review: identify recurring careless mistakes, weak sections, and time sinks.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Because ISC-style assessment rewards clear method and structured answers, practising presentation (headings, labelled diagrams, units, and stepwise calculations) is as important as solving the question.<\/p>\n<h2>Sample revision roadmap (subject to your pace)<\/h2>\n<p>The following compact plan shows how toppers space revision and practice without burning out. Adjust daily hours to fit your school schedule.<\/p>\n<div class=\"table-responsive\"><table border='1' cellpadding='6' cellspacing='0'>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Phase<\/th>\n<th>Focus<\/th>\n<th>Typical Activities<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Initial Build (8\u201310 weeks)<\/td>\n<td>Concepts + worked examples<\/td>\n<td>Read core chapters, make notes, solve guided problems<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Practice &#038; Consolidation (6\u20138 weeks)<\/td>\n<td>Topic-wise practice + mini-tests<\/td>\n<td>Past-paper questions by topic, timed sections, targeted revision<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Mock &#038; Fix (4\u20136 weeks)<\/td>\n<td>Full-length mocks + error correction<\/td>\n<td>Weekly full papers, detailed marking, focused rework of weak areas<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Final Polishing (1\u20133 weeks)<\/td>\n<td>Quick revision + formula sheets<\/td>\n<td>Short notes, speed drills, light mocks and rest<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table><\/div>\n<h2>Note-taking, summaries and making books &#8216;your&#8217; resource<\/h2>\n<p>Toppers turn books into personal notebooks. The goal is to condense long chapters into revision-ready notes: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Create one-line summaries for each section and a one-page chapter summary.<\/li>\n<li>Maintain a formula sheet and a \u2018common mistakes\u2019 page per subject.<\/li>\n<li>Use colour coding for definitions, steps, and common pitfalls so your brain retrieves fast under time pressure.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Remember: diagrams and derivations are learning tools \u2014 they help you understand and remember, not rigid templates to be reproduced mindlessly in exams. Practice redrawing and explaining them in your own words.<\/p>\n<p><img src='https:\/\/asset.sparkl.me\/pb\/blogs-image\/img\/6ad634420f75425385176a276b507bdf.jpg' alt='Photo Idea : A student annotating a textbook with colored sticky notes and a highlighter'><\/p>\n<h2>When a book doesn\u2019t work \u2014 smart ways to switch or supplement<\/h2>\n<p>If a book leaves you confused after two chapters, switch. Toppers don\u2019t collect books as trophies; they swap to clarity. But switching should be measured: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Give any new book at least two chapters\u2019 worth of honest effort.<\/li>\n<li>If it still doesn\u2019t click, pick a different resource that explains the same topic in another style (visual, step-by-step, or problem-first).<\/li>\n<li>Limit your primary resources to two per subject: one for theory and one for practice\/revision.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Integrating personalised guidance with your books<\/h2>\n<p>Top students often combine books with occasional personalised help to target blind spots faster. Toppers use them for three things: familiarisation, time management, and identifying recurring themes. When you solve a past paper, mark it strictly and rewrite the answers you missed. Over time you build an internal checklist of common question formats and the precise wording examiners reward.<\/p>\n<h2>Exam-day presentation and book habits that earn marks<\/h2>\n<p>Books teach content; practice teaches presentation. Tips toppers never forget on exam day: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Begin answers with clear labels and brief introductions where required.<\/li>\n<li>Show all method steps for calculations \u2014 method marks matter.<\/li>\n<li>Underline or box final answers and ensure units are present.<\/li>\n<li>Keep diagrams neat, labelled, and referenced to the question parts.<\/li>\n<li>Manage time: divide total duration by marks to allocate time per question type.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Common pitfalls and how the right books prevent them<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Over-dependence on summaries \u2014 toppers read summaries, then revisit the chapter for depth.<\/li>\n<li>Practising only easy questions \u2014 use graded practice and include harder variants.<\/li>\n<li>Poor answer structure \u2014 model-answers and marking-smart books train structure.<\/li>\n<li>Neglecting practicals and projects \u2014 use lab manuals and workbook-style resources for hands-on rehearsal.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Quick checklist toppers run before picking a book<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Does it map to the ISC syllabus units?<\/li>\n<li>Are examples worked stepwise and clearly explained?<\/li>\n<li>Is there a healthy mix of short and long questions, and full-length papers?<\/li>\n<li>Does it help you present answers in a marking-smart way?<\/li>\n<li>Can you realistically complete its practice sets within your schedule?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Final practical tips: turning pages into performance<\/h2>\n<p>Choose clarity over quantity, practise deliberately, and test yourself under real exam conditions. Use books to build a layered preparation: learn the concept, practise targeted questions, then simulate full papers. Keep concise notes for last-minute revision, and make sure every resource you keep serves a clear purpose in your study plan.
